The SABIAN 18" AAX X-Plosion Crash cymbal is a robust choice in the crash-cymbals category, offering a combination of size, material, and finish that appeals to many musicians. This 18-inch cymbal is made from bronze, which is known for its durability and bright sound. The brilliant finish not only adds a visually appealing shine but also tends to produce a brighter tone compared to traditional finishes.
This particular model is noted for its penetrating definition and power, making it suitable for cutting through in loud music environments, such as rock or metal bands. Its size provides a good balance between volume and sustain, making it versatile for various styles. One of its key strengths is its ability to maintain presence and power, ensuring it stands out in a mix. However, it may be too aggressive for genres that require a softer, more subtle approach.
Another point to consider is that the cymbal does not come with any included components, such as a stand, which might be an additional cost for some users. The Sabian STRATUS Zero Crash Cymbal is an 18-inch cymbal made from B20 bronze, which is known for its durability and bright sound quality. The inclusion of aero holes adds a unique high-end sizzle and a trashy attack, making it a versatile choice for drummers looking for a distinctive sound. This cymbal works well both individually and as part of a stack with the S1816 Chinese, offering flexibility in a drum setup.
The natural finish gives it a classic look, while the polished finish type ensures it maintains its aesthetic appeal over time. At 2.57 pounds, it is lightweight and easy to handle, which is advantageous for gigging musicians. However, its specific appeal might be more niche due to its trashy sound profile, which may not suit all musical styles.
